Navigating Parental Benefits and Work-Life Balance
This chapter examines the role of organizations in providing parental benefits amid legal slowdowns, highlighting the disparity in access based on socioeconomic status. It addresses the challenges faced by middle-class working mothers and calls for governmental intervention to promote equitable parental leave. The chapter also discusses practical advice for managers to support working parents and the unintended consequences of workplace policies like unlimited vacation.
